Can I use poured chocolate ganache on top of buttercream iced cake? Any rules I should know about? Thanks!

I have many times. I would let the buttercream crust very well and make sure the ganache is cool. do you want to completely cover the cake or just let it drip down the sides?

anytime that i have done this method. i ice the cake smooth with b/c . let set up.. the pour warm ganache over the cake, starting in the middle out. this was how i was shown how to use poured ganache.
